當前位置:首頁 » 編程語言 » sql數據加上一條記錄
擴展閱讀
愛國者存儲王h8175250g 2023-02-01 01:31:54
web原版 2023-02-01 01:28:35

sql數據加上一條記錄

發布時間: 2022-11-27 17:51:56

A. 在資料庫中添加一行的sql語句怎麼寫

在資料庫中添加一行的SQL語句寫法的步驟如下:

我們需要准備的材料分別是:電腦、sql查詢器。

1、首先,打開sql查詢器,連接上相應的資料庫表,以stu2表添加一行數據為例。

B. sql語句怎麼添加一條記錄

sql語句中,添加記錄的語法為:insert into 表名 (col1,col2....coln)values(value1,value2.....valuen);

其中,如果你插入的每一列都是順序插入,無一缺漏的話,(col1,col2...coln)可以省略。

也就是上式也可以簡化為:insert into 表名values(value1,value2.....valuen);

看了你寫的sql代碼,問題出在insert into 的整體語句出現在了不該出現的地方,只需做一點小改動即可解決,如下圖:

解析:insert into語句需要在user表已經存在的情況下才可以使用。而你原來的語句中,將上圖2中的語句插入到了create table user的語句中,致使create table user 語句未能成功執行,所以才會報錯。

而將「INSERT INTO user(uid,tel) values('甲','3354986');」整條語句直接拿出來放在「ENGINE=InnoDB DEFAULT CHARSET=gbk;」後面之後,整個sql就可以順利執行了。

(2)sql數據加上一條記錄擴展閱讀:

當mysql大批量插入數據的時候就會變的非常慢,mysql提高insert into 插入速度的方法有三種:

1、第一種插入提速方法:

如果資料庫中的數據已經很多(幾百萬條), 那麼可以加大mysql配置中的 bulk_insert_buffer_size,這個參數默認為8M

舉例:bulk_insert_buffer_size=100M;

2、第二種mysql插入提速方法:

改寫所有 insert into 語句為insertdelayed into

這個insert delayed不同之處在於:立即返回結果,後台進行處理插入。

3、第三個方法: 一次插入多條數據:

insert中插入多條數據,舉例:

insert into table values('11','11'),('22','22'),('33','33')...;

C. 如何直接在sql server中添加一條數據

1、打開heidisql客戶端,新建一個連接,連接sql server的資料庫,選擇資料庫的類型,埠號一般是1433;如果是mysql的資料庫,一般埠是3306。

拓展資料:

SQL Server 是一個關系資料庫管理系統。它最初是由Microsoft Sybase 和Ashton-Tate三家公司共同開發的,於Microsoft SQL Server1988 年推出了第一個OS/2 版本。在Windows NT 推出後,Microsoft與Sybase 在SQL Server 的開發上就分道揚鑣了,Microsoft 將SQL Server 移植到Windows NT系統上,專注於開發推廣SQL Server 的Windows NT 版本。Sybase 則較專注於SQL Server在UNIX 操作系統上的應用。

D. SQL中insert添加記錄的三種方法

1、直接添加

insertinto表名values(.......)

2、插入記錄來自另外的表

insertinto表名1select*from表名2where.....

3、還有一種屬於表不存在,同時建表及插入數據

select欄位1,欄位2...into新表from舊表

E. SQL資料庫怎麼插入一條記錄

一般情況sql資料庫插入數據有兩種辦法,一種是使用sql標准化語句,就是insert語句。另外一種是直接打開SQL的數據端客戶端,打開相應的表,然後選擇加號直接就可以輸入數據啊。

F. 如何使用SQL語句往資料庫中添加一條空記錄

比如一個表有id和name欄位
但是你只想往id欄位里插入,但是你首先要保證name欄位允許為空
1
insert
into
表名(id)
values
(1);
2
insert
into
表名
values
(1,null);
以上兩種情況都可以插入,你試驗一下

G. SQL語句向表中插入一行記錄

INSERT INTO 語句

INSERT INTO 語句用於向表格中插入新的行。

語法

INSERTINTO表名稱VALUES(值1,值2,....)

也可以指定所要插入數據的列:

INSERTINTOtable_name(列1,列2,...)VALUES(值1,值2,....)

H. 如何在ORACL資料庫中用SQL語言加一條記錄

通過sql語句向oracle資料庫中加一條記錄,一般情況下,可直接使用insert語句,
如:insert
into
test(ID,NAME)
values(1,』zhangsan』);
若插入主鍵時,不能直接寫主鍵值,而應該通過序列得到下個主鍵值。
如:向表test中插入一條數據,ID為主鍵,序列為test_Seq
錯誤的寫法:
insert
into
test(ID,NAME)
values(10,』zhangsan』);
正確的寫法:
insert
into
test(ID,NAME)
values(test_Seq.nextval,』zhangsan』);

I. 用SQL命令插入一個記錄

1、在資料庫中建立一張test表,可以看到test表中有id,name,second三個欄位,id設置為自動遞增,